What Exactly Is Emergency Chiropractic Care?

Emergency chiropractic involves prompt, priority chiropractic evaluation and treatment for acute musculoskeletal trauma. Unlike standard chiropractic visits that address chronic or long-term conditions, emergency chiropractic centers on stabilizing the body after a sudden event so that inflammation, spinal misalignment escalate. Time is critical — the sooner a licensed chiropractor examines a fresh trauma, the better the outcome.

Mechanically, emergency chiropractic operates through restoring correct orientation to the vertebrae and surrounding structures. When a fall disrupts the musculoskeletal system, joints can lock out of optimal alignment, compressing the surrounding tissues that radiate outward from the cervical and lumbar regions. A trained chiropractor uses controlled manual manipulation techniques to re-establish proper segmental motion and decrease nerve irritation.

The techniques used in emergency chiropractic may incorporate gentle mobilization, soft tissue therapy, flexion-distraction, and rehabilitative stretches. The Emergency Chiropractic Procedure Step by Step

  1. Emergency Arrival and Check-In — When you walk through the doors of our office, our administrative team expedites your paperwork to cut down on wait time. You'll briefly describe the circumstances of your accident, how it happened, and your current symptoms. Timeliness at this stage allows the doctor has the information needed to initiate the examination right away.
  2. Clinical Examination — A licensed chiropractor performs a thorough physical and neurological examination. This covers manually assessing the vertebral column, assessing joint mobility, and pinpointing areas of restriction. When warranted, radiographic assessment can be performed on the same visit to screen for structural damage before physical therapy is initiated.
  3. Diagnosis and Treatment — Based on the assessment results, your provider identifies the specific injuries contributing to your functional limitations and explains a transparent care roadmap. This step confirms you understand what structures need attention and what the intervention is intended to address.
  4. Hands-On Treatment — The heart of emergency chiropractic intervention is the chiropractic adjustment. Using calculated pressure, the chiropractor returns restricted joint levels to their intended position. Based on your specific condition, this may include upper spinal correction, mid-back therapy, lumbar manipulation, or multiple regions together.
  5. Supportive Manual Therapies — After the primary manipulation, your clinician may deliver myofascial modalities such as manual trigger point therapy, cold laser treatment, or anti-inflammatory modalities to address secondary spasm and support the recovery timeline.
  6. Post-Visit Self-Care — Before you leave, your chiropractor delivers specific at-home recovery instructions. These usually cover icing schedules, movement modifications, positional guidance, and gentle stretches intended to support the corrections made during your urgent session.
  7. Ongoing Treatment Planning — Emergency chiropractic typically requires a brief course of subsequent appointments to thoroughly treat the initial condition. Your chiropractor sets up follow-up care before you walk out, so that continuity is in place from the very start.

Who Is a Solid Candidate for Emergency Chiropractic Care?

Emergency chiropractic is appropriate for a wide range of patients. Those who tend to respond well include patients of motor vehicle accidents dealing with whiplash, head and neck discomfort, or back-related dysfunction. Workplace injury victims — most often those in manual labor jobs — also benefit from prompt emergency chiropractic evaluation. Similarly, sports participants who experience severe musculoskeletal setbacks in training regularly turn to emergency chiropractic care to stay active.

People dealing with newly developed spinal disc injuries, acute sciatic pain, rib subluxations, or post-accident restricted motion are all good candidates for emergency chiropractic treatment. However, some individuals is a suitable candidate. Those with active fractures may require medical intervention before chiropractic care can safely proceed. The chiropractors at our practice consistently screen for red flags during the intake assessment.

People who are nursing, those with certain vascular histories, or those already being treated for complex neurological disorders should discuss their full health background prior to beginning emergency chiropractic care. Emergency Chiropractic Frequently Asked Questions

How long does an emergency chiropractic session take?

A initial emergency chiropractic visit typically takes between 45 minutes to just over an hour, depending on the scope of your injuries. This covers check-in, the comprehensive examination, same-day radiographic assessment, and the hands-on chiropractic care itself. Follow-up emergency chiropractic appointments typically run less time as your team already is familiar with your injury.

Is emergency chiropractic uncomfortable?

The majority of individuals report that emergency chiropractic care result in little to no soreness during the appointment itself. Some people feel mild after-adjustment muscle aching — much like how you feel after a physical training. This commonly clears within one to two hours. Our clinical team use controlled pressure tailored to your specific injury severity.

When will I experience results from emergency chiropractic care?

A large number of individuals experience significant pain relief right after their first emergency chiropractic session. Total improvement is influenced by the severity of the trauma, your physical baseline, and the degree to which you maintain your outlined treatment protocol. Newly sustained injuries treated right away through emergency chiropractic generally improve in less time than conditions which have been left untreated.
